  • Allows quick, simple installation and removal of pipes and hoses.

  • Fewer components means fewer potential points of leakage.

  • Corrosion-resistant brass design

  • Lower costs through quicker installation and repair.

  • Meets international DIN, DOT and SAE regulations.

  • Suitable for compressed air as operating medium.

  • Reliably maintains maximum operating pressure in accordance with DIN 74324.

  • Operates reliably at temperatures of -40 °C to +100 °C. At temperatures below +2 °C, please observe the requirements regarding compressed air quality.

  • Compatible with hoses in accordance with DIN 74324.

  • Features robust brass components, a nickel plated pipe reinforcing sleeve, a multi-tooth clamping ring and a Buna N O-ring (low-nitrile) for reliable sealing.
Notice

All pipes, regardless of material, tend to vibrate and move once they reach a certain length. For this reason, secure the brake line pipes (diameter 5 to 16 mm) to the bodywork or chassis with rubberised pipe clamps where possible. Maintain clamp spacing of 1 m to maximum 1.20 m.

  • Screw connectors meet the requirements of DIN 74324

  • Screw connectors meet the requirements of the Department of Transport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(DOT FMVSS 106) and the Society for Automotive Engineers (SAE J1131)

  • Screw connectors are TÜV tested and approved for use in pneumatic brake systems

  • on commercial vehicles
